Practically everything engineers have to interact with and consider are equivalent to a software black box. Rainfall, winds, tectonic shifts, material properties, etc. Humans don't have the source code to these things. We observe them, we quantify them, notice trends, model the observations, and we apply statistical analysis on them.

And it's possible that a real engineer might do all this with an AI model and then determine it's not adequate and choose to not use it.
